Which cranial nerves has parasympathetic motor output
posledela

These fibers provide vis- ceral motor (parasympathetic) innervation to the viscera. The only cranial nerves that transmit parasympathetic fibers are the oculomotor, facial, glossopharyngeal, and vagus nerves.

I’m which structure is all the genetic information of an organism found?
Likurg_2 [28]

Answer;

-DNA

Explanation;

-DNA stands for deoxyribonucleic acid. It's the genetic code that determines all the characteristics of a living thing.

-It contains the genetic instructions for the development and function of living things. These instructions are needed for an organism to develop, survive and reproduce. To carry out these functions, DNA sequences must be converted into messages that can be used to produce proteins, which are the complex molecules that do most of the activities in our bodies.
